It was generated by gdoc. .TH "gsasl_saslprep" 3 "1.10.0" "gsasl" "gsasl" .SH NAME gsasl_saslprep \- API function .SH SYNOPSIS .B #include .sp .BI "int gsasl_saslprep(const char * " in ", Gsasl_saslprep_flags " flags ", char ** " out ", int * " stringpreprc ");" .SH ARGUMENTS .IP "const char * in" 12 a UTF\-8 encoded string. .IP "Gsasl_saslprep_flags flags" 12 any SASLprep flag, e.g., \fBGSASL_ALLOW_UNASSIGNED\fP. .IP "char ** out" 12 on exit, contains newly allocated output string. .IP "int * stringpreprc" 12 if non\-NULL, will hold precise stringprep return code. .SH "DESCRIPTION" Prepare string using SASLprep. On success, the \fIout\fP variable must be deallocated by the caller. Return value: Returns \fBGSASL_OK\fP on success, or \fBGSASL_SASLPREP_ERROR\fP on error. .SH "SINCE" 0.2.3 .SH "REPORTING BUGS" Report bugs to . .br General guidelines for reporting bugs: http://www.gnu.org/gethelp/ .br GNU SASL home page: http://www.gnu.org/software/gsasl/ .SH COPYRIGHT Copyright \(co 2002-2021 Simon Josefsson. .br Copying and distribution of this file, with or without modification, are permitted in any medium without royalty provided the copyright notice and this notice are preserved. .SH "SEE ALSO" The full documentation for .B gsasl is maintained as a Texinfo manual.
